Know what the course regulations are as well as the proper etiquette. This is important because you will find that etiquette is very important in the game. For example, when somebody is preparing to take a shot, be quiet. Don’t talk as its distracting. Also, be sure that you stand far away enough so as when you swing, the player is not going to have to worry about hitting you. You must also not stand along the target line – give your buddy a fine view of the hole.
